Can Vagisil be used to treat a yeast infection?
For a yeast infection, the infection is inside your vagina so you'd need to get OTC (over-the-counter) yeast infection medications. Those come with an insertable applicator to put the medicine inside of you to kill off the yeast. Vagisil is only used on the vulva, or outside the vagina, and is not a preferred treatment for a yeast infection.

Can you have a reaction to Vagisil?
Allergic Skin Reaction: this can be caused by many products. These may be benzocaine (in Vagisil anti-itch cream) and antibiotic ointments. Latex condoms, nail polish, and perfumes may also cause a reaction. Stop using products that cause the allergic reaction.

What is a vagisil cream?
Vagisil is a medicated cream, and its active ingredient is 2 percent lidocaine. Vagisil is mainly used for providing relief from the uneasiness due to minor itching and irritation of the skin just outside of the vagina.

Does Vagisil help with itching?
Vagisil mostly contains topical gels to numb the itching. As it has no antibacterial or antifungal activity, it does not protect against infection. If there is itching along with significant white discharge and smell, it is better to seek medical consultation.
